Step-by-Step Guide to Implementing Core Values Communication Strategies
1. Embed Values in Campaign Storytelling
- Identify unique stories: Pinpoint your sustainable wood sourcing and artisan craftsmanship.
- Create a content calendar: Schedule blogs, emails, and social posts that consistently showcase these stories.
- Use emotional hooks: Craft compelling headlines like “From Forest to Playroom” to engage your audience.
- Add clear CTAs: Encourage action with prompts such as “Learn More About Our Sustainable Journey.”
2. Leverage Customer and Artisan Testimonials
- Collect testimonials: Use post-purchase emails and artisan interviews to gather authentic feedback.
- Produce multimedia: Create short videos and quote graphics featuring these testimonials.
- Integrate testimonials: Place them on product pages, social media, and campaign materials.
- Segment testimonials: Tailor testimonial use based on customer demographics or psychographics.
3. Use Visual Content to Demonstrate Authenticity
- Plan visual shoots: Capture your workshop, raw materials, and eco-packaging in photos and videos.
- Publish consistently: Share behind-the-scenes content on Instagram Stories, TikTok, and your website.
- Tell stories with visuals: Accompany images with captions explaining the craftsmanship and eco-friendly process.
- Repurpose content: Use visuals in newsletters and ads to reinforce your brand values.
4. Personalize Messaging Based on Customer Insights
- Segment your audience: Use purchase data and survey responses to group customers by values and interests.
- Craft tailored messages: Develop unique content for segments like eco-conscious parents or gift buyers.
- Automate delivery: Use platforms such as HubSpot or Mailchimp for personalized email flows and retargeting.
- Test and optimize: Continuously refine messaging based on engagement metrics.
5. Collect Campaign Feedback to Refine Messaging
- Deploy quick surveys: Use mobile-friendly tools like Zigpoll post-campaign to assess messaging clarity and emotional impact.
- Ask targeted questions: Focus on authenticity, understanding of values, and emotional connection.
- Analyze responses: Identify messaging gaps or areas needing emphasis.
- Iterate messaging: Apply insights to future campaigns for continuous improvement.
6. Maintain Multi-Channel Consistency for Attribution Clarity
- Map customer touchpoints: Outline where and how customers interact with your brand.
- Standardize messaging: Use consistent hashtags, slogans, and imagery across channels.
- Implement attribution models: Use U-shaped or time-decay models with tools like Google Attribution to assign credit accurately.
- Monitor analytics: Track cross-channel engagement and conversions to validate messaging effectiveness.
7. Highlight Certifications and Eco-Labels Transparently
- Secure certifications: Obtain relevant eco-labels such as FSC or Organic.
- Educate customers: Create website pages explaining each certification’s meaning and importance.
- Feature logos prominently: Display certification marks on packaging, ads, and digital platforms.
- Communicate benefits: Use campaigns to explain how certifications align with your environmental values.

FAQ: Answers to Common Questions About Communicating Core Values
How can I clearly communicate craftsmanship in my campaigns?
Showcase behind-the-scenes visuals and artisan stories. Use videos where craftsmen explain their process and the care invested in each toy.
What’s the best way to demonstrate environmental commitment effectively?
Highlight concrete actions like sustainable wood sourcing and eco-friendly packaging. Feature third-party certifications and tell stories about your green practices.
How do I measure if my core values communication is working?
Track engagement metrics such as click-through rates and time on page, conversion rates, and customer feedback scores like NPS. Use attribution tools to link campaigns to leads and sales.
Can personalization improve values communication?
Absolutely. Tailored messages based on customer interests deepen emotional connections and increase campaign effectiveness. Use segmentation and automation to deliver relevant content.
